How this figure is calculated
Population - Est. & Proj. — Rural population divided by GDP (current US$), matched on country and year. Neither publisher issues this ratio as a series; it is computed here from both.
Population - Est. & Proj. — Rural population ÷ GDP (current US$)
Computed from
- Population - Est. & Proj. — Rural population Food and Agriculture Organization of the United Nations
- GDP Country official statistics, National Statistical Organizations and/or Central Banks
Statizoid computes this series; the underlying measurements belong to the publishers named above. The arithmetic is applied to every country and year where both inputs report, and nothing is estimated unless the page says so.
